Transaction 212542bb98ab1e21586d24f89a9222b70361a82785851cafc902562cd075daeb
1 Input
1 Output
-
212542bb98ab1e21586d24f89a9222b70361a82785851cafc902562cd075daeb:0
- value
- 6840258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9384065a275ccac02db771e7049a3793200a098 OP_EQUAL
- address
- 3MVZwbbKU4fbR5ahLf69f3md6B8fBghN7C